Our Newfoundland and Labrador Operations are an integrated mining, milling, and processing operation. Nickel concentrate from the fly-in, fly-out Voisey's Bay operation is shipped to our state-of-art Long Harbour Processing Plant where it is refined into low-carbon and high-purity nickel rounds, cobalt rounds and copper cathodes.

The Opportunity

We are currently seeking an Employee Health Specialist to join our Health, Safety, and Risk Department in St. John's, NL. This permanent position will be a Monday to Friday schedule working at the St. John's Corporate Office in St. John's, NL with regular travel to both Long Harbour and Voisey's Bay as required.

As an Employee Health Specialist, you will a member of Vale's Health, Safety, and Risk team reporting to the HSR Manager. In this role, you will support employees who are missing or performing modified work duties due to a health issue by connecting them with appropriate resources and facilitate their return to work. Duties will include ensuring appropriate classification and reporting (internal and external) of injuries. Other duties include the promotion of health and wellness within the Vale Newfoundland and Labrador (VNL) Operations by interacting directly with site personnel and advising on health and wellness programs such as mental health, fatigue, medicals & medical surveillance, disability management, worker's compensation, and Drug & Alcohol Program administration.

Additionally, in this position you will:
  • Re-evaluate and revamp a VNL Disability Management Program. Proactively establish and execute early and safe return to work plans with Site Management, monitor trends in disability claims and recommend proactive measures to reduce workplace injuries to VNL leadership. Ensure all legal and legislative requirements are met as per the appropriate compensation board's standards. Administer program and act as lead on program.
  • Manage worker's compensation cases and maintain strong relationships with Workplace NL and medical providers.
  • Act as the Program Administrator and provide oversight of VNL's Drug and Alcohol Program.
  • Lead an initiative to establish and administer Physical Demands Analyses (PDAs) for roles within VNL.
  • Review and maintain VNL pre-employment and periodical medical Policy for alignment with Vale North Atlantic and industry best practice.
  • Work closely with site HSR team members, medical service provider contractors and Human Resource Business Partners.
  • Monitor health data and identify trends to determine areas of focus for VNL leadership that will emphasize the right work to promote health and wellness of all employees.
  • Regularly travel to VNL sites to build and maintain relationships with stakeholders, provide support to our operational team by participating in risk assessments, providing health/wellness sessions, and assisting as other needs arise.
  • Identify ways to firmly establish mental health as part of the business routines.
  • Advise on fatigue management best practices through monitoring trends, reviewing industry best practices and provide recommendations for improvements/advancements to programs. Once a program is established, act as owner.
